Ellicottville is home to two of the East’s premier ski resorts, which means we are also home to a colorful bunch of ‘ski bums’. These folks make the first tracks in the morning, catch the last chair of the evening, and still make last call. Our smooth auburn winter ale is a cheers to them! Brewed with centennial hops, moderate bitterness.

Sampled on draft at Urban Tap this beer poured an orange-amber color with a medium sized foamy orange-white head that left good lacing. The aroma was stone fruits, malt and a touch of medicine. The flavor was malty with light apricot, mild astringency. and an off medicinal note. Medium length finish. Medium body.

Bottle @ home, picked up at Boulder Liquor Mart. Pours a hazy dark reddish orange appearance with a cream colored head. Bland, bitter hops in the nose. Very light citrus, a little pine, caramel. A little chalky in the mouth. Moderately spicy. Medium plus bitterness. Moderate sweetness. Toasted bread, light pine, dough. Boring.

12oz bottle from Wegmans, West Seneca, NY. A hazy amber pour with a scummy white head that laces the glass completely; citrus aroma with perhaps a trace of pineapple; big citrus hop taste, quite bitter and with a touch of spice; and a dry moreish finish.
